The Rainbow Lorikeet, Trichoglossus haematodus is a species of Australasian parrot found in Australia along the along the eastern seaboard, from Queensland to South Australia and northwest Tasmania and in the South West Pacific.
Its habitat is rainforest, coastal bush and woodland areas.
Their intense colours have patches of emerald green, orange midnight blue, dull blue, ruby red, lemon yellow, purple, violet greenish grey.
Surprisingly enough this colourful bird can be hard sometimes to pick out in its natural habitat. See below.
